Essential Functions of a SWD (Student With Disability)
Para Educator:
Prepare educational materials under the direction of the teacher. Carry out instructional behavioral programming planned by the teacher for individual students or groups of students. Assist students in the lunchroom, or other areas as assigned. Supervise student programs including behavior management and non-violent crisis intervention procedures. Assist students with assignment completion, drill, practice and test preparation. May perform procedures such as catheterization and gastrostomy feedings, after appropriate training is provided. Accompany students to the lavatory when required and provide assistance such as changing soiled clothing or soiled diapers.
